Identifying shapes and understanding addition are fundamental skills for children aged 5-7, forming the bedrock for future mathematical learning. At this age, children's cognitive abilities are rapidly developing, and they begin to explore and categorize the world around them. Recognizing shapes like circles, squares, and triangles helps children connect geometric concepts with real-world objects, enhancing their spatial awareness and problem-solving skills.
Moreover, addition introduces children to the concept of combining quantities, promoting logical reasoning and critical thinking. Mastering these foundational math skills can significantly boost a child's confidence and motivation in learning. When parents and teachers prioritize shape identification and addition, they are not just teaching basic skills; they are fostering a love for learning and laying the groundwork for more complex subjects in the future.
Additionally, engaging in activities that involve shapes and addition can promote interactive learning experiences, benefiting social development as children work in groups or pairs. These early mathematical experiences are crucial because they influence academic achievement later in schooling. By recognizing the importance of these concepts, parents and teachers can inspire curiosity and a lifelong passion for mathematics in young learners.
